To A Poet Of Quality. Praising The Lady Hinchinbroke Poem Rhyme Scheme and Analysis
Rhyme Scheme: ABBB CDCD| Of thy judicious Muse's sense | A |
| Young Hinchinbroke so very proud is | B |
| That Sacharissa and Hortense | B |
| She looks henceforth upon as dowdies | B |
| - | |
| Yet she to one must still submit | C |
| To dear Mamma must pay her duty | D |
| She wonders praising Wilmot's wit | C |
| Thou shouldst forget his daughter's beauty | D |
Matthew Prior
